Clear Books VS Sage Group

Sage Group is the top competitor of Clear Books. Sage Group was founded in 1981, and its headquarters is in Newcastle-Upon-Tyne, England. Like Clear Books, Sage Group also operates in the Software, Internet & Computer Services field. Sage Group has 10,772 more employees than Clear Books.

Clear Books VS FreeAgent

FreeAgent is seen as one of Clear Books's top competitors. FreeAgent was founded in Edinburgh, Scotland} in 2006. Like Clear Books, FreeAgent also works within the Software, Internet & Computer Services field. Compared to Clear Books, FreeAgent generates $14.3M more revenue.

Clear Books VS FreshBooks

FreshBooks is Clear Books's #3 rival. FreshBooks's headquarters is in Toronto, Ontario, and was founded in 2003. Like Clear Books, FreshBooks also operates in the Software, Internet & Computer Services sector. FreshBooks generates 6,949% of Clear Books's revenue.
